Home prices increased in Poolesville during 2021

The median sale price of a home sold in 2021 in Poolesville rose by $24,300 while total sales increased by 30.7%, according to BlockShopper.com.

From January through December of 2021, there were 115 homes sold, with a median sale price of $480,000 - a 5.3% increase over the $455,700 median sale price for the previous year. There were 88 homes sold in Poolesville in 2020.

The median sales tax in Poolesville for the most recent year with available data, 2020, was $4,649, approximately 1% of the median home sale price for 2021.
